Faris Yakob (off of TIGS) has written a great guest post about Brand You over at Gaping Void.

Faris writes that you never know what you’re going to end up being famous for, but that you need to start being you – because Brand You is a highly defensible asset.  He suggests you take advice from Shakespeare and to thine own self be true.
